This detailed description of the invention is made up of inside and outside twice curtain wall, forms the space of a relative closure between inside and outside curtain wall, Air can enter from bottom air inlet 3, leaves this space from top exhaust outlet 4 again, and this space is often in air stream Dynamic state, heat is at this spatial flow.Its energy-saving principle is: winter, closes air inlet 3, exhaust outlet 4, due to the photograph of sunlight Penetrating, in making the passage of heat, temperature raises, and as a room, is equal to improve the hull-skin temperature of internal layer heat insulation glass 2, decreases and build Build thing heating time and operating cost;Double glazing wall at dusk has heat-blocking action in summer, in summer, opens passage of heat air inlet 3, exhaust outlet 4 can realize outer circulation and ventilates, utilize what air flow hot pressing principle (gravity-flow ventilation), and generation is from bottom to top Air warm-up movement, is discharged outside by 4 hot-airs of exhaust outlet thus reduces internal layer heat insulation glass 2 temperature, serve heat insulation work With.
This detailed description of the invention maximum feature is by forming a ventilation layer between inside and outside two-layer curtain wall, due to this The effect circulated or circulate of air in ventilation layer, makes the temperature of internal layer curtain wall close to indoor temperature, reduces the temperature difference, thus it compares Energy 42%-52% is saved during traditional curtain wall heating;Energy 38%-60% is saved during refrigeration;In order to improve energy-saving effect, in passage It is provided with electric-powered shutter 6;Additionally, due to the use of double-layer curtain wall, the soundproof effect of whole curtain wall is greatly improved, every Sound performance can reach 55dB, improves indoor comfort degree.
The installation procedure of this detailed description of the invention is: datum mark confirms and installs built-in fitting → surveying setting-out → adaptor peace The lifting of dress → cell board and water-proof sealing process, and use flute profile built-in fitting, synchronize pre-buried, be embedded in structural beams side during structure construction Face, is connected with adaptor by T-bolt, safe and reliable, and regulation performance is good, and its special connected mode can absorb bigger Civil engineering error, has bigger regulation surplus, the most simply can be connected with multiple adapting system, reduces working procedure.
The lifting of unit plate is the part that during cell curtain wall is installed, workload is maximum, and the difficult point in this stage is at plate Transport, the lifting of plate and grafting, plate three operations of adjustment on:
(1) transport of plate: vertical transport uses tower crane to carry out, and plate is mainly sent into the Hoisting Position specified;Flat Row transport, when lifting, this transport vehicle sectional disassembles, and during to adapt to lifting, plate is steeved the movement needs moved ahead.
(2) lifting of plate and grafting: the lifting of plate and descending during, people to be arranged on the flooring of descending process Member, carries out the enforcement of protective measure, collides with main body during to prevent plate from waving, cause the destruction of plate plate;Insert When connecing, levels is provided with installation personnel, first realizes the docking of left and right seam, then realizes the docking of upper and lower plate.
(3) adjustment of plate: carry out the adjustment on six-freedom degree direction after docking, the principle of adjustment is smooth vertical and horizontal, And guarantee that suspension member contacts and stress with the effective of adaptor.
(4) installation of rotation angle position unit plate: the especially needed attention of installation of rotation angle position unit plate is corner The installation of place's connector, the connector including cylinder is installed, and should control this by the connector the most adjusted during construction The connector deviation at place.
(5) shell nosing treatment of type unitized curtain wall: such as the facilities such as vertical external elevator, tower crane ability when engineering finishes up in engineering Can remove, the unit plate at this position also can only be installed in the engineering later stage;For type unitized curtain wall, due to conventional structure Limiting, the grafting of last plate of interlayer almost cannot realize.To this end, to having carried out spy at closing in design of node Not considering, limit, start element plate left and right is directly expected for double public affairs, and seals limit, cell board left and right and directly expect for double mothers, to ensure closing in plate Easy for installation, keep its water proofing property and air-tightness good.
